新聞中心
在當(dāng)今的數(shù)字化時代,服務(wù)器內(nèi)存的重要性不言而喻,隨著技術(shù)的發(fā)展和業(yè)務(wù)的增長,服務(wù)器內(nèi)存的占用可能會變得越來越高,這不僅會影響服務(wù)器的性能,還可能導(dǎo)致系統(tǒng)崩潰,如何解決這個問題呢?本文將為您提供一些解決方案。

創(chuàng)新互聯(lián)是一家業(yè)務(wù)范圍包括IDC托管業(yè)務(wù),虛擬空間、主機(jī)租用、主機(jī)托管,四川、重慶、廣東電信服務(wù)器租用,綿陽機(jī)房托管,成都網(wǎng)通服務(wù)器托管,成都服務(wù)器租用,業(yè)務(wù)范圍遍及中國大陸、港澳臺以及歐美等多個國家及地區(qū)的互聯(lián)網(wǎng)數(shù)據(jù)服務(wù)公司。
1、優(yōu)化應(yīng)用程序
我們需要檢查并優(yōu)化運行在服務(wù)器上的應(yīng)用程序,許多應(yīng)用程序可能會消耗大量的內(nèi)存資源,這可能是導(dǎo)致內(nèi)存占用高的主要原因,我們可以通過以下方式來優(yōu)化應(yīng)用程序:
使用內(nèi)存管理工具:這些工具可以幫助我們更好地管理和監(jiān)控內(nèi)存使用情況,從而找出并解決內(nèi)存泄漏問題。
優(yōu)化代碼:我們可以通過優(yōu)化代碼來減少內(nèi)存的使用,我們可以使用更有效的數(shù)據(jù)結(jié)構(gòu)和算法,或者避免不必要的內(nèi)存分配。
2、增加服務(wù)器內(nèi)存
如果優(yōu)化應(yīng)用程序后,服務(wù)器內(nèi)存的占用仍然很高,那么我們可能需要考慮增加服務(wù)器的內(nèi)存,增加內(nèi)存可以有效地提高服務(wù)器的性能和穩(wěn)定性,這需要考慮到成本和空間的限制。
3、使用虛擬內(nèi)存
虛擬內(nèi)存是一種將硬盤空間作為內(nèi)存使用的技術(shù),當(dāng)物理內(nèi)存不足時,操作系統(tǒng)會將部分?jǐn)?shù)據(jù)存儲到硬盤上,從而釋放出更多的物理內(nèi)存,雖然虛擬內(nèi)存不能替代物理內(nèi)存,但它可以有效地緩解內(nèi)存不足的問題。
4、使用負(fù)載均衡
負(fù)載均衡是一種將工作負(fù)載分散到多個服務(wù)器上的技術(shù),通過使用負(fù)載均衡,我們可以有效地提高服務(wù)器的處理能力,從而降低單個服務(wù)器的內(nèi)存壓力。
5、定期重啟服務(wù)器
定期重啟服務(wù)器可以幫助我們釋放掉不再使用的內(nèi)存,從而降低內(nèi)存的占用,重啟服務(wù)器還可以幫助我們解決一些由于長時間運行而導(dǎo)致的問題。
以上就是解決服務(wù)器內(nèi)存占用高的一些方法,每種方法都有其優(yōu)點和缺點,我們需要根據(jù)實際情況來選擇最適合的方法。
相關(guān)問題與解答:
1、Q:我應(yīng)該如何判斷服務(wù)器內(nèi)存是否過高?
A:你可以通過查看服務(wù)器的運行狀態(tài)來判斷,如果服務(wù)器的CPU使用率持續(xù)很高,或者經(jīng)常出現(xiàn)性能下降的情況,那么可能是內(nèi)存過高導(dǎo)致的。
2、Q:我增加了服務(wù)器的內(nèi)存,但是內(nèi)存占用仍然很高,這是為什么?
A:這可能是因為你的應(yīng)用程序沒有充分利用增加的內(nèi)存,你可能需要優(yōu)化你的應(yīng)用程序,使其能夠更好地利用內(nèi)存。
3、Q:我可以使用虛擬內(nèi)存來解決內(nèi)存不足的問題嗎?
A:是的,虛擬內(nèi)存可以有效地緩解內(nèi)存不足的問題,虛擬內(nèi)存不能替代物理內(nèi)存,它只能作為臨時的解決方案。
4、Q:我應(yīng)該如何優(yōu)化我的應(yīng)用程序?
A:你可以通過使用內(nèi)存管理工具來優(yōu)化你的應(yīng)用程序,這些工具可以幫助你找出并解決內(nèi)存泄漏問題,你還可以通過優(yōu)化代碼來減少內(nèi)存的使用。
文章題目:服務(wù)器內(nèi)存占用率過高怎么辦
網(wǎng)站路徑:http://www.dlmjj.cn/article/dpoeips.html


咨詢
建站咨詢
